First V3 Tesla Supercharger in Quebec now open in Sherbrooke

The first V3 Tesla Supercharger in Quebec was activated by Tesla technicians in Sherbrooke this morning.

A total of eight stalls are now operational at 1900 QC-216 on the north side of the city, along Hwy 610.

Sherbrooke will make it as the first operational V3 in the province of Quebec, as well as the first V3 in the 5 easternmost provinces. Other V3 Superchargers are awaiting activation in Boisbriand, Matane and Charlottetown (PEI).

The new station will better serve people coming from the north (Quebec City) as well as those heading east, while Magog remains an essential charging spot for travellers on Hwy 10.

The first charge was reported on the morning of September 22nd by a “Model 3 en Français” member (Facebook)

 

Speeds of 250kW were reported later in the day (Photo via TMC)
